Researchers have developed ProtoCAM, a novel interpretable few-shot learning framework designed for breast lesion classification in ultrasound imaging. This method integrates mask-guided feature encoding and prototypical metric learning to improve classification accuracy with limited training data. Evaluations on the BUSI dataset showed ProtoCAM achieving a macro F1-score of 0.910 in a 3-way 5-shot setting, with ResNet18 as a backbone reaching 91.65% in a 15-shot configuration, offering interpretable insights into its diagnostic decisions.
